Beach Volleyball Joins Raft Race in Portrush
The inaugrual NIVA Exhibition Beach Volleyball Event saw 13 players draw a crowd of over 500 on Portrush Beach. First up was Ding and Tom v VAIs Johnny and Odhran in a 24 - 22 tight match taken by the away team. Next was Chloe and Julia v Zdenka and Marie (VAI) with a 21 - 14 win to the home side. The last match was a cracker with Graeme and Ross, both 19, losing out 21 - 19 to Olaf and Seb from Brazil.
This was followed by a fun 6 event and then a 'tag' match of NI v away players with any 2 on court. NI lost out in the 3rd set.
The weather was fantastic and the layout of the court with the music and DJ gave a professional feel. The event was heavily promoted with banners and radio announcements so come Sunday everyone was talking about it. Hopefully this can be built upon for next year in an even bigger event.

NIVA Women’s Beach Tour Gets Under Way
|
 |
|
Craigavon Aztecs hosted the season opener for the 2008 NIVA Women’s Beach Tour at Portadown Sand Pad. A completely new line-up filled the entry card for the event, which introduced a completely new format for the Tour.
Melissa Traynor and Lucy Moore got the event underway with a 21-9, 21-10 win over local pair Fabiana and Charlotte.
Traynor and Moore continued their run of form with a narrow win over Emma and Sonia, before losing their first set in a close match against Rebecca and Michelle.
They stormed back to win the second set by 11 points and won the match, to finish top of the table for the event.

QUB's Hamilton and Pilch Win First Beach Event of the Summer
|
 |
|
A strong field lined up on Saturday 31st May at Portadown Sand Pad for the opening tournament on the NIVA Men’s Beach Tour 2008.
Former Tour winners and Olympic hopefuls rubbed shoulders with local players on a beautiful day with perfect conditions for volleyball – sunny and still.
The tournament format of two qualifying groups meant that the top ranked teams avoided each other in the opening matches.

NI Beach Volleyball Tour Dates 2008
|
 |
|
The NIVA beach tour begins Saturday 31st May at the Portadown sand facility. Registration is at 10.00am. This year you must first register with NIVA prior to competing in any tour event. The one-off NIVA registration fee is £5.00 for the season and you can register at any of the events with a NIVA official. The event fee is £15 per pair to be paid at the event.
You can register your team for entry to the Portadown leg of the tour either through the forum or in person with Alan Templeton or Paul McIlweaine or by email to aztecsvc@hotmail.com or paul.mcilwaine@lineone.net

Urban Beach Volleyball Tour
|
 |
|
September 16th saw the final leg of the UK tour here in Belfast. The set up took 2 days and was covered by UTV Life. 200 tons of sand, frame, grandstand seating, marque, DJ equipment, jacuzzi etc were all in place come Thursday morning for the 1 o clock press call. On Thurs and Fri Denise Austin ran coaching sessions for our junior NI squad players and a fun 6 competition ran each evening with teams including Civil Service and North Down Lizards.
